Microsoft’s Universal Store Team (UST) enables one of Microsoft’s most business-critical needs: electronic monetization of products and services. UST is developing some of Microsoft’s largest scale, most business-critical cloud services. These services have a huge global footprint of over 240 markets and processes millions of transactions daily, with loads growing as Microsoft moves to a fully cloud-powered services and devices company.
The platform powers all of Microsoft’s key businesses – Azure, Office 365, XBOX, Windows App Store, Windows Phone, Bing Ads to name just a few. The platform also powers the licensing business for millions of customers large and small, enabling them to use Microsoft software and services across cloud, on-premises, and hybrid scenarios. Whether renting a movie or buying a game on Xbox LIVE, purchasing an app on a Windows or Windows Phone device, signing up for an Office 365 subscription or paying for Azure services, you are using Universal Store.
The Service Engineering and Technical Operations (SETO) team is building a Site Reliability Engineering (SRE) expertise to approach the operations problem from an engineering mindset. Our team is looking to hire an extremely talented and result oriented Senior level software engineer for our SRE team. This person will be responsible for all aspects of the engineering (design, develop, quality, deployment, service availability & reliability). They will partner closely with peer SRE and feature teams to deliver highly reliable automation systems. This role may involve contributing to service feature code.
Leadership: ready to take bold bets and make the right decision. Set the tactical vision for the project and deliver the results. Make right engineering decision to strike optimal balance between agility and reliability of the service
Partnership: being a good partner with feature teams and other SRE teams. Demonstrate deep understanding of partner team needs and come up with an engineer’s approach to problem solving.
Engineering: Design, write and deliver software to improve the availability, reliability, scalability, latency, security, resiliency, and efficiency of a service. Contribute towards architecture, design, coding, documentation and troubleshooting of full stack of a service; write software and build automation to resolve problems permanently. Participate actively in code reviews, bug/issue triage and support well informed decisions towards business and engineering goals. Review and influence ongoing design, architecture, standards and methods for operating services and systems. Participate in periodic on call duties
•Bachelor’s or Master’s degree in Computer Science or a related field
•6-8 years’ experience in software engineering is must
•Outstanding coding chops in C# or other C-family languages
•Experience in Production engineering or Site reliability engineering of cloud scale service
•Superior communications skills, both verbal and written
•Experience working on big-data and distributed computing solutions
•Experience of driving deep technical discussion into service design, operating systems, networking, storage, monitoring, and capacity planning
•Experience in cloud - Azure, AWS in IaaS, PaaS or SaaS.
Microsoft is an equal opportunity employer. All qualified applicants will receive consideration for employment without regard to race, color, sex, sexual orientation, gender identity or expression, religion, national origin or ancestry, age, disability, marital status, pregnancy, protected veteran status, protected genetic information, political affiliation, or any other characteristics protected by local laws, regulations, or ordinances.
A little about us:
Microsoft offers training and employment opportunities to help you turn your military experience and skills into a civilian technology career.